The size of Windaroo is approximately 1.9 square kilometres. It has 6 parks covering nearly 36.6% of total area. The population of Windaroo in 2016 was 2827 people. By 2021 the population was 2771 showing a population decline of 2.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Windaroo is 10-19 years. Households in Windaroo are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Windaroo work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 85.00% of the homes in Windaroo were owner-occupied compared with 80.40% in 2016.
